From EMV Software :

Warblade is a PC arcade shoot’em up game with focus on very good playability. An alien race is invading the Earth and you must try to save humanity. The game is a remake for the PC of my Amiga game Deluxe Galaga. Was one of Adrenaline Vaults top shareware games. Got Ernie award for most addictive game. Features and settings include: 100 Action filled levels, Powerfull profile system, Up to 10 users, 15 time trial levels, Online Hall of Fame Lots of bonuses and powerups, 3D rendered graphics, High quality music and sfx, Use your own music, Save and load games.

    From WOODE Soft :

    Your mission is to rescue prisoners of war (POWs) from enemy territory. Fly your helicopter into one of the three hotzones and pick up the POWs and bring them safely back to your homebase. You must defend your helicopter against enemy air-to-air attacks from attack helicopters and defend your helicopter against enemy ground-to-air attacks from troopers on the ground. The difficulty of the game will increase with each level you advance. The last two hotzones in the game, will be unlocked as you advance in level. Please try to avoid shooting the POWs, this isn’t Lemmings.

    From Rawr Team :

    Rawr is a program for comparing and exploring gear for Bears, Cats, Moonkin, Healadins, Retadins, Mages, DPS Warriors, Protection Warriors, Trees, Hunters, Protection Paladins, Healing Priests, Shadow Priests, Enhancement Shamans, Warlocks, Rogues, Restoration Shamans, Elementals, and DPS and Tank Death Knights, in the MMORPG World of Warcraft. Rawr has been designed from the start to be fun to use and helpful in finding better combinations of gear and what gear to obtain.

    Features include a user-friendly interface; the ability to load your character from the Armory, automatically download info about items it doesn’t know about, download info about possible upgrades, and download info about specific items you tell it to, ensure that you won’t need to type in any item stats with Rawr; the most comprehensive, and most accurate system for calculating your character stats, and ratings for individual items, based on your current gear, enchants, and buffs.

    From Paul Burkey :

    Fruix is a new Fruit sorting action puzzle game. This is a Fruit matching logic puzzle game with a focus on planning ahead and thoughtful rotations. Each turn you must remove any two fruits from the board. The remaining fruit falls down and fruit groups are made. At any time you can rotate the whole board to optimize your rewards. With timed and relaxed modes this is a colorful puzzler for all ages.

    From Paul Burkey :

    CornerChaos is a very unique puzzle game. It’s very easy to learn and great fun to play. The object of the game is to drop the colored balls into the holes located near the four corners of the play area. The ball then rolls into the sloped arena and lays to rest. If four balls of like color are touching, they’re removed from the game.

    As the levels progress, the number of different balls increases making it more difficult to create color groups.

    From G4Box :

    Cross Fire is an online military first-person shooter for the PC, developed by SmileGate and published by G4BOX. Players assume the role of either a Black List or Global Risk operative, and then compete in modes including Team Death Match and the exclusive stealth-action ghost mode.

    Cross Fire also will include a persistent military ranking system, in-game friends lists, a clan formation system, and deep character customization options. Cross Fire will always be free-to-download-and-play.
